Another option for getting to St Andrews is taking the Airlink (Service 100) bus, which runs 24/7 from outside the domestic arrivals area. You can buy tickets at the kiosk, on board, or online at Lothian Buses. St Andrews Airport transfer, This service will drop you at Edinburgh Waverley station, from which you can catch a train to Leuchars station, the closest stop to St Andrews.

The number 99 bus runs every 15 minutes between Leuchars and St Andrews bus station, but it may not be available early in the morning or late at night. If you’re travelling during these times, we recommend staying overnight in one of the airport hotels.

If you’d prefer a more cost-effective option, you can take the 747 airport bus from Stance G at the airport to Halbeath Park and Ride and then transfer to the Stagecoach X24 or X59 bus to St Andrews. St Andrews Airport transfer, The journey normally takes two hours.

A minibus is a small vehicle that can seat up to 16 people. It is often used for a variety of purposes, including private and corporate travel. There are many different models of minibuses, each with unique features and specifications. Some of the most popular manufacturers include Mercedes-Benz, Opel, Volkswagen and Ford. In addition, some manufacturers also produce vehicles specifically designed for special uses, such as a mobile classroom, exam center, or blood testing centers.

If a minibus is operated for hire or reward, it must be licensed as a passenger carrying vehicle (PCV). The maximum weight of a passenger-carrying minibus is 3.5 tonnes (3500 kgs), excluding specialist equipment for the carriage of disabled passengers. The vehicle must display a valid minibus permit and a driving licence for the driver.

Organisations that operate transport services on a not-for-profit basis can apply for a Section 19 or Section 22 permit to allow them to drive and operate a minibus without the need for a full Public Service Vehicle operator’s licence (PSV – category D). The vehicle must be in good working order and have a fully qualified driver at all times.
